Closing Team Member Job Description
The goal of this position is to execute closing processes at the end of the day. This includes cleaning dishes, machines, and floors at the end of the night.
An ideal candidate for this role should be someone who is able to work independently and possesses an eye for detail. Members of the Closing Team arrive one hour before the closing of the restaurant and stay until the restaurant is properly cleaned and able to close.
